Father Tom Uzhunnalil talks to journalists during a press conference in Rome on Saturday. He was abducted in 2016 by Islamic State militants in Yemen. AP
Father Tom Uzhunnalil was abducted from Yemen's port city of Aden in 2016, but was released last week. He was transferred to Muscat and then flown to his home in Kerala on Tuesday. AP
Addressing the media for the first time, Uzhunnalil thanked all the people involved in his rescue, including his relatives and friends who prayed for his safety. AP
Father Tom was abducted by militants in March 2016, when they attacked the missionary home he was working in. Sixteen other people, including four nuns, were killed in the attack. AP
